[teiid-issues] [JBoss JIRA] (TEIID-2320) non pushable uncorrelated exists subquery will still be pushed

> The evaluation flag on the the exists predicate is not getting cloned properly, which means that an exists predicate that should be pre-evaluated (due to not being pushed-down) will instead be pushed down.
